Bill 107, the Stop Harmful Gambling Advertising Act, 2026, is a private or government bill introduced in the Ontario Legislature during the 44th Parliament's first session. Its stated purpose is to address harmful gambling advertising. The bill passed First Reading on April 20, 2026, proceeded to Second Reading debate on May 13, 2026, but was ultimately defeated on division at the Second Reading vote on May 14, 2026.
